Excerpt from Review of the Administration's Federal Crop Insurance Reform Proposal, Vol. 2
Ad hoc disaster assistance was unpredictable in that it required emergency appropriations, which in turn generally required large regional disasters that were subject to the political whims of the moment. Producers could not budget for it, and it made financial planning for them and for lending institutions virtually impossible.
